Soliton-like excitation in a nonlinear model of DNA dynamics with viscosity
The study of solitary wave solutions is of prime significance fornonlinear physical systems. The Peyrard-Bishop model for DNA dynamics isgeneralized specifically to include the difference among bases pairs and vis-cosity.
